Output 6f508b75b4eb26b86554dfe39b84534771c12328ed607cc687c396299ba1af45:93

value
194232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c5fecbb95e589a609c9231c60b9fb26b6518188 OP_EQUAL
address
3FwrFSHxqJp6zcSzmbDNR51VoGzGyDovMK
transaction
6f508b75b4eb26b86554dfe39b84534771c12328ed607cc687c396299ba1af45
spent
true